😐A single person spends $1,283 per month in Ramallah vs $1,093 in Al-birah, rent included.
😐A couple spends around $2,108 per month in Ramallah vs $1,896 in Al-birah, rent included.
😐A family of three spends $2,934 per month in Ramallah vs $2,699 in Al-birah, rent included.
😐Ramallah costs about 17% more than Al-birah,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.
📊Both Ramallah and Al-birah are more affordable than the global median – Ramallah4% lower, Al-birah18% lower.

🏠A central one-bedroom costs $442 in Ramallah versus $358 in Al-birah.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.
🛒A mid-range dinner for two costs $55.0 in Ramallah versus $42.00 in Al-birah.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$287 vs $220 – making Al-birah the more affordable choice for daily food spending.
